What is the Iowa Amended Individual Income Tax Return?
The Iowa Amended Individual Income Tax Return, known as the IA 1040X form, is a crucial document for individuals seeking to amend their previously filed income tax returns in Iowa. This form is primarily used to correct any errors or omissions in the original return or to report any changes in income or deductions. Taxpayers who have realized a mistake after their initial filing should consider using this form to ensure their tax obligations are accurately represented.
Purpose and Benefits of the Iowa Amended Tax Return
Filing the Iowa Amended Tax Return can provide several important benefits. Individuals who notice discrepancies, such as unreported income or incorrect credits, may wish to amend their return to claim additional refunds. Additionally, correcting previous errors can prevent potential penalties and interest that might accrue on unpaid tax liabilities. Overall, the amended return serves to rectify financial reporting, leading to compliance with tax laws in Iowa.
Who Needs to File the Iowa Amended Tax Return?
Certain demographics should consider filing the Iowa Amended Individual Income Tax Return. Taxpayers who have made errors in their previous filings, as well as spouses filing jointly who have discrepancies, must take action. Individuals who have experienced changes in their financial situation, such as marriage or divorce, might also need to file this form to update their tax records accordingly.

Field-by-Field Instructions for the Iowa Amended Tax Return
When completing the Iowa Amended Tax Return, it is essential to understand the significance of each field on the form. Key fields include "Your last name," which must exactly match the taxpayer's name registered with the IRS. The "Signature" field indicates the need for both taxpayer and spouse signatures when applicable. Ensuring that these fields are filled out correctly can prevent processing delays and issues with the Iowa Department of Revenue.
Common Errors and How to Avoid Them
Many users encounter frequent pitfalls when filling out the Iowa Amended Tax Return. Common errors include failing to sign the form, entering incorrect Social Security Numbers, or neglecting to report income accurately. To avoid these mistakes, take the time to double-check all entries and utilize any validation tools provided by tax software. Adopting a meticulous approach can help ensure your amended form is processed smoothly.
Where to Submit the Iowa Amended Individual Income Tax Return
After completing the Iowa Amended Individual Income Tax Return, the next step is submission. Taxpayers have the option to submit their forms online or by mailing them to the appropriate Iowa Department of Revenue address. Deadlines for submission can vary, so it is crucial to verify current submission timelines to avoid late filing penalties. Be sure to keep confirmation of your submission for your records.
What Happens After You Submit the Iowa Amended Tax Return?
Upon submission of the Iowa Amended Tax Return, taxpayers can expect a processing period during which the Department of Revenue reviews the amended filing. Typically, processing can take several weeks, and users may track the status of their application online. If there are discrepancies or issues, notifications will be sent outlining necessary steps to rectify any problems, allowing for prompt resolution.

Who is eligible to file the Iowa Amended Individual Income Tax Return?
Any Iowa resident who previously filed an individual income tax return can file the Iowa Amended Individual Income Tax Return if they need to make corrections to that return.
What are the deadlines for submitting an amended return in Iowa?
Amended returns typically should be filed within three years of the original filing date. It’s important to check the Iowa Department of Revenue for specific dates and any changes.
How can I submit my amended return once completed?
You can submit the Iowa Amended Individual Income Tax Return by mailing it to the designated address provided in the instructions or using pdfFiller for electronic submission, if available.
What documents do I need to include with my Amended Return?
You should have your original tax return and any supporting documentation that justifies the amendments, such as new income statements or deduction-related paperwork.
What common mistakes should I avoid when completing my amended return?
Common mistakes include failing to sign the form, forgetting to include all necessary corrections, and not checking for accuracy in reported income or deductions.
How long does it take to process the amended Iowa tax return?
Processing times can vary, but it generally takes the Iowa Department of Revenue several weeks to review your amended return and issue any refund or correspondence.
What happens if I owe additional tax on my amended return?
If you owe additional taxes, you should pay the amount due when you submit the amended return to avoid penalties and interest.
